Attention!

When you use a series of vectors for chromosomal integration, please note that not all the transformants are proper integrants.
According to the previous paper [Genetics. 1994;136(3):849-56.], this phenomenon occurs due to gene conversion.
Although it was reported that gene conversion occurs in nearly 30% of the transformants, we estimate that this frequency is less than 10% in our integration systems.
But we recommend to check expression of the tagged proteins before you use in your experiment.
It is enough to check two transformants in most cases.

Additional information

And also, please note that the LR reaction should be carried out using low concentration of entry clones and destination vectors.
Although we do not know the reason, it is very difficult to obtain correct expression plasmids when high concentration of vectors and entry clones are used in the reaction.
We usually use about 10 ng (or less) of each plasmid in the LR reaction.
The reaction volume can be reduced to at least 3 microliter for cost saving.
